The Florida wind mitigation form is a form used to assess the wind-resistant features of a home or building.
Homeowners in Florida are typically required to file the wind mitigation form with their insurance company.
The wind mitigation form can be filled out by a qualified inspector who assesses the wind-resistant features of the property.
The purpose of the wind mitigation form is to determine the level of risk associated with wind damage to a property, which can impact insurance premiums.
The form typically requires information on the age of the roof, type of roof covering, roof deck attachment, roof geometry, and more.
